Transaction f4eef571454c80d4a627c335dafc720e13ae272cb02b78997e0f979f1d1b77b2

19 Input
1 Outputs
  • f4eef571454c80d4a627c335dafc720e13ae272cb02b78997e0f979f1d1b77b2:0
  • value  13939815
    address  3GiXn6fpk5vwE67GZcDxQERygicMrJsGN3